Frequently Asked Questions
What is the average MOT pass rate for a Skoda Citigo?
The Skoda Citigo has an average 88.5% MOT pass rate across model years 2011 to 2019, based on DVSA test data.
What are the most common MOT failures on a Skoda Citigo?
The most common MOT failure reasons for the Skoda Citigo across all years are: a tyre seriously damaged, tyre tread depth not in accordance with the requirements, a suspension pin, bush or joint excessively worn. These are typical wear items that can often be checked and addressed before your test.
